Description:
The Great Sphinx is one of the world’s largest sculptures, measuring some 240 feet long and 66 feet high. It features a lions body and a human head adorned with a royal headdress.
The statue was carved from a single piece of limestone, and pigment residue suggests that the entire Great Sphinx was painted. It would have taken about three years for 100 workers, using stone hammers and copper chisels, to finish the statue.
